The term "efficiency factor" can refer to different concepts depending on the context in which it's used. Generally, it signifies a measure of how effectively a particular process, system, or machine converts inputs into useful outputs. Here are a few specific interpretations across various fields: 1. **Engineering and Physics**: In engineering contexts, the efficiency factor may refer to the ratio of useful output power to total input power in a system. It is often expressed as a percentage.
